Notes
Horace
Bushnell
was
born
in the
village
of
Bantam
in
Litchfield
,
Connecticut
and
educated
at
Yale
College
. An
influential
minister
and
theologian
, he
served
as
minister
of
Hartford's
North
Congregational
Church
for
more
than
twenty
years
.
